BIG MAX adds two new designs to AQUA range

The AQUA golf bag range from BIG MAX is set to expand for another season as the brand adds two new designs to the award winning series.

100 per cent waterproof, with sealed seams and specially designed Japanese waterproof zippers, the Aqua range offers an un-matched level of waterproofing and will keep all a golfers’ gear dry all year round. Ultra-lightweight, tear resistant materials complete the robust practicality of construction and then each bag in the series adds its own take on making a golfer’s life on the course that little bit easier.

The BIG MAX Aqua V-1 offers all the practicality of the most spacious Tour bag and then adds innovation that makes it distinctly BIG MAX. The V-1 incorporates the first SPORT ORGANISER on the golf market. The new, patented V-Lock System uses a simple Turn & Lock technology that keeps all a golfer’s woods locked in place, leaving an unobscured view of the irons and an easy choice of every club for the next shot.

With 14 full length dividers, including oversize putter well for large grips, nine waterproof pockets, two cooler pockets and a dedicated battery pocket, the Aqua V-1 gives a golfer with all the gear simplicity of use, Tour bag storage and unrivalled waterproof practicality.

The BIG MAX Aqua Style takes classic design and spacious capacity while keeping overall weight down to just 2.1kg. A 14 way divider top, oversize putter well and 9 waterproof pockets keep all a golfers clubs and gear neatly organised while the classic design in five different colour combinations helps the Style live up to its name.
